Headline: Belarus-Latvia border crossing attempts pick up again
Short Summary: Renewed attempts by migrants to cross from Belarus into Latvia have been observed, indicating another wave of hybrid activity on the border.
Description and Notes
Latvian authorities report a renewed increase in attempts by migrants to cross the Latvia-Belarus border illegally, as stated by Interior Minister Rihards Kozlovskis on February 22, 2024.
Notes: Weaponized migration
Evidence
- "Attempts by migrants to cross the Latvian-Belarusian border illegally have resumed, Interior Minister Rihards Kozlovskis (New Unity) told Latvian Radio on February 22."
- "As of February 20, officials decided to detain all the perpetrators trying to illegally cross the border to the Republic of Latvia from Belarus."
- "Last year 13,980 people were prevented from crossing the state border illegally, while 428 were admitted for humanitarian reasons."
